What is a Refrigerator Without a Freezer Compartment?
A refrigerator without a freezer compartment is a specialized home appliance designed to supply sufficient cooling and storage area for perishable items without the included freezer area. These models are generally narrower and offer more flexible storage choices, dealing with a wide variety of consumer requirements.
Key Features of Refrigerators Without Freezer Compartments
Increased Fridge Capacity: These fridges feature bigger refrigerator areas because there's no freezer compartment taking up valuable area.

Optimal Temperature Control: They preserve a stable temperature, making them ideal for storing perishable items like fruits, veggies, dairy, and beverages.

Energy Efficiency: Models without a freezer typically take in less energy compared to their freezer-equipped counterparts.

Style and Aesthetic Choices: Many of these refrigerators can be found in sleek styles that can fit seamlessly into different kitchen area designs.

More Shelf Space: Without a freezer using up an area, users can delight in extra shelving and more comprehensive area for items.

Greater Efficiency: Saves on energy bills due to lower power intake, and potentially longer life due to less regular defrosting.

Simplicity: Easier to browse and arrange with less compartments and functions.
Cons
No Freezer Space: Lack of a freezer area might be a dealbreaker for families who make use of frozen foods for benefit or bulk storage.

Restricted Food Preservation Options: Certain items like ice cream or frozen meals might need alternative storage solutions.

Possible Increased Frequency of Grocery Trips: Users may need to shop more often if they mainly take in fresh foods.

Frequently asked questions About Refrigerators Without Freezer Compartments
1. How do I select the right size refrigerator without a freezer?Consider your kitchen layout, offered space, and your everyday food storage requirements. Measure the area where the refrigerator will sit before purchasing.

2. Are these refrigerators energy-efficient?Yes, fridges without a freezer compartment typically use less energy due to their uncomplicated style and lack of freezer operation.

3. Can I store frozen products in these fridges?No, these models are designed particularly for refrigeration. If you need frozen storage, think about alternative services, such as a standalone freezer.

4. How typically should I clean my refrigerator?Regular cleansing is recommended every 1-3 months, ensuring correct upkeep and health.

5. What features should I try to find in these models?Try to find adjustable racks, humidity control drawers, energy efficiency rankings, and sufficient storage options matched to your requirements.
